It’s time to transform patient recruitment

The clinical trial landscape has changed dramatically. Protocols are more complex, patient needs have evolved, and regulatory standards are ever-changing. Globalization has made finding patients even more challenging. Yet, patient recruitment strategies have remained stagnant, leading to an 80% clinical trial failure rate and $40 billion in unrecoverable losses. (BioPharma Dive. January 29, 2019.)
